Flights from London to Manchester
With Manchester becoming an increasingly important business hub in the UK, there is plenty of demand for fast flights to the north-west from the capital. Business travellers and tourists can take frequent direct flights from London Heathrow Airport to Manchester seven days a week. Flights are provided by the national carrier, with daily take-off times including morning, afternoon and evening options. Flight times on the short hop north to Manchester are just over an hour.
Which airlines fly from London to Manchester?
British Airways, the UK's national airline, provides all the daily direct flights to Manchester from London Heathrow. Given the short distance for this UK domestic flight to Manchester and the frequency of the direct services, it is not practical to book indirect connections on this route.
How long is the flight from London to Manchester?
At just 163 miles, the journey north-west from London Heathrow to Manchester is one of the UK's shortest internal connections. The fastest flights from London to Manchester are the British Airways morning and evening departures, taking one hour to cover the route. Most BA flights take five or ten minutes longer to complete the trip from Heathrow to Manchester.
How many flights are there from London to Manchester?
The British Airways schedule provides six daily direct flights between London Heathrow and Manchester from Tuesday-Thursday, seven on Fridays, five on Sundays and Mondays and four on Saturdays. Departure times to Manchester always include morning, afternoon and evening flight options.
What are the departure and arrival airports for flights from London to Manchester?
Departure airport: Passengers will depart from London Heathrow. Europe's busiest airport, London Heathrow is about 14 miles west of central London, with rail connections available on the Underground, taking about 40 minutes to reach the terminals, and by Heathrow Express trains, taking 15 minutes from Paddington Station. The airport has long and short stay parking, numerous duty-free shops, food supermarkets, business lounges, and free WiFi.
Arrival airport: Passengers will arrive at Manchester Airport. Located about ten miles south-west of the city centre, Manchester Airport has public transport links on 24-hour bus services and its own rail station with trains taking about 20 minutes to reach central Manchester. Facilities in the airport terminals include car hire desks, fast food outlets, a pub, bakery, coffee shops, business amenities, and free WiFi.
